After America starring Yvonne Freese, Theresa McConnon, Daniel Nies, Ahmed Yusuf has a NR rating, a runtime of about 2 hr 7 min, and a scheduled release date of February 12th, 2021.

It received a user score of 57/100 on TMDb, which collated reviews from 2 top users.

Curious about the story behind it? Here's the plot: "A group of criminal justice de-escalation workers in Minneapolis embark on a collaborative film project that uses radical workshop techniques to explore their real-life struggles to escape the pressures of the American dream." .
